Abstract
- The development of pulsed power puts forward new requirements on volume and weight of generators. To develop a compact and lightweight high-voltage pulse generator, this work proposed a new modular pulse forming topology with high voltage gain and a reduced number of energy storage capacitors. The topology is realized by charging a set of capacitors cyclically step-by-step and discharging repetitively in series. A voltage gain of $2^{n-1}$ can be achieved with $2n\,+\,1$ all-solid-state switches, $n$ fast recovery diodes, and n capacitors. An experimental prototype built around five capacitors generates high-voltage pulses with adjustable voltage level, pulse frequency, and pulsewidth. Meanwhile, it is verified that the prototype has a certain capacity with a capacitive load. [ABSTRACT FROM AUTHOR]
